Senate has three months to pass permitting reform, GOP negotiator warns

Published January 22, 2026 3:23pm ET



EXCLUSIVE — A top House Republican cautioned that the Senate has just a matter of months to pass meaningful legislation accelerating the process for permitting energy and infrastructure projects, as the midterm elections inch closer and bipartisan support wavers.

House Natural Resources Committee Chairman Bruce Westerman (R-AR), a critical figure in advancing permitting legislation to the Senate last December, told the Washington Examiner that he is confident that Congress will still be able to send permitting reform to President Donald Trump’s desk this year.
